The market capitalization of Insulet is $9.15B. Market capitalization is a measure of the total market value of a publicly traded company. It is calculated by multiplying the current stock price by the total number of outstanding shares.
The Price-to-Earnings (P/E) ratio (TTM) for Insulet is 26.16. This ratio helps investors assess whether a stock is overvalued or undervalued compared to its earnings.
Insulet's Earnings Per Share (EPS) over the trailing twelve months (TTM) is $5.044. EPS indicates the company's profitability on a per-share basis.
Currently, 28 analysts cover Insulet's stock, with a consensus target price of $169.86. Analyst ratings provide insights into the stock's expected performance.
Over the trailing twelve months, Insulet reported a revenue of $3.05B.
Insulet's Ear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ation, and amortization (EBITDA) over the trailing twelve months is $639.60M. EBITDA measures the company's overall financial performance.
Insulet has a free cash flow of $293.80M. Free cash flow indicates the cash generated after accounting for cash outflows to support operations and capital assets.
Insulet employs approximately 5,400 people. It operates in the Health Care sector, specifically within the Medical Specialties industry.
The free float of Insulet is 69.06M. Free float refers to the number of shares available for public trading, excluding restricted shares.

Insulet Corp. is a medical device company, which engages in the development, manufacture, and marketing of an insulin infusion system for people with insulin-dependent diabetes. It specializes in diabetes supplies, including the OmniPod System, as well as other diabetes related products and supplies such as blood glucose testing supplies, traditional insulin pumps, pump supplies, and pharmaceuticals. The company was founded by John L. Brooks III and John T. Garibotto in July 2000 and is headquartered in Acton, MA.
